Home Remedies for Migraine Attacks

All of us experience migraine attacks once in a while and it surely is totally discomforting.  Our works and daily routines are disrupted as we opt to just lie down and sleep it away after ingesting pain relievers.  In my case, migraine usually attacks when I’m severely stressed and exhausted.  Luckily, the pain easily paves away from me with just Biogesic or a Mefenamic Acid.  Also, I implore these simple home remedies for added comfort:

1. Cold compress over the head and eyes.

2. Good head/scalp massage.

3. Rest in a quiet, preferably dark, cozy room away from noise and other disturbances.

4. Aromatherapy with lavender and peppermint.

5. Staying well hydrated so drink lots of water.
